SPA 1 ROSEVIEW WSF - ARSENIC TREATMENT
LAST UPDATED:
10/30/2009
PROJECT
20521
DEPARTMENT
PUBLIC WORKS - UTILITIES
PROJECT MANAGER
Lee Lambert
CONTACT NUMBER
623.222.7032
ADDRESS/LOCATION
13280 W. Country Gables Drive
PROJECT DESCRIPTION
Design and construction of a 1,000 gallons per minute (gpm) arsenic treatment plant at the Roseview Water Supply Facility (Roseview Well 1 and Litchfield Manor Well 1). Using a series of treatments, filters, tanks, and pumps, raw water is piped through the arsenic removal treatment plant. Treated water is compliant with the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) arsenic level standards.

BUDGET NOTES
Budget decrease of $1,000,000 January 07. Budget increase of $2,200,000 July 07. Budget transfer increase of $23,400 Sept 08 for a portion of the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) related costs. Budget - FY08 - $106,400, FY09 - $1,764,700, FY10 - $352,200
PROJECT UPDATE
CURRENT PROJECT STATUS
The application for Approval of Construction has been submitted, and we are currently waiting as the County reviews the information and determines the status. Final retention payment for the construction is scheduled to go out in the next 30 days or less.
WHAT'S NEXT
The Engineering firm will be paid for final documents and then the project will be closed.
